Cleaning Your Ninja PossibleCooker PRO After Summer Use

Keeping your Ninja PossibleCooker PRO clean is key to maintaining its performance and longevity. After each use, unplug the device and allow it to cool completely before cleaning.

  • Wipe down the exterior with a damp cloth to remove food splatters and dust from outdoor use.
  • Remove and clean the inner pot with warm, soapy water. For stubborn stains, soak the pot briefly before scrubbing gently.
  • Clean the sealing ring and lid thoroughly to prevent odors and ensure a proper seal for next time.

Always dry all parts completely before reassembling or storing to prevent mold and corrosion, especially in humid summer environments.

Summer outdoor cooking can sometimes introduce challenges like overheating, inconsistent heating, or electrical issues. Here are some tips to troubleshoot common problems:

  • Overheating or Error Messages: Ensure the device is placed on a heat-resistant, level surface away from direct sunlight. Check the power cord and outlet for secure connections.
  • Inconsistent Cooking: Make sure the inner pot and lid are properly seated. Clean the temperature sensors if you notice uneven cooking.
  • Device Not Starting: Confirm that the control panel isn’t wet or dirty. Reset the device by unplugging it for a few minutes before trying again.

For persistent issues, consult the user manual or contact customer support to prevent further damage and ensure safety.

Maintaining Your Multi-Cooker’s Performance in the Heat

High summer temperatures can affect your Ninja PossibleCooker PRO’s operation. To keep it running smoothly:

  • Store the appliance in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ight when not in use.
  • Periodically check the power cord and plug for any signs of wear or damage.
  • Avoid pouring cold liquids into the hot inner pot immediately after use to prevent thermal shock.

Using the oven-safe feature up to 500°F allows for finishing dishes outdoors, but always monitor temperature settings and avoid overloading the device during hot days.
